HC Deb 31 January 1984 vol 53 c175W
Mr. McCusker

asked the Secretary of State for Northern Ireland (1) how many advance factories built in Northern Ireland since 1973 had oil-fired boilers; and how many had coal-fired boilers;

(2) how many factories owned by the Department of Economic Development (NI) have been converted from oil-fired to coal-fired boilers during the past 10 years.

Mr. Butler

A total of 44 advance factories of various sizes have been provided from public funds in Northern Ireland since 1973. All have been equipped with oil-fired boilers.

There have been no requests from tenants of factories owned by the Department of Economic Development and managed by the Industrial Development Board for conversion to coal-firing during this period. However, in line with the Government's policy to ensure wherever possible the efficient use of energy, the Industrial Development Board is reviewing its approach to heating installations in advance factories.
